Bentley Engines Limited (/ˈbɛntli/) can be a British company that patterns, develops, and manufactures luxury motorcars which are largely hand-built. It is a part of Volkswagen AG. Now based in Crewe, England, Bentley Motors Limited seemed to be founded by W. O. Bentley on 18 January 1919 in Cricklewood, North London.Bentley cars are distributed via franchised dealers throughout the world, and as of Nov 2012, China was the largest market.Most Bentley cars are assembled at the Crewe factory, but a small amount of Continental Flying Spurs are assembled on the factory in Dresden, Germany. Bodies for the Continental are stated in Zwickau, Germany.Bentley won the a day of Le Mans within 1924, 1927, 1928, 1929, 1930, and 2003.

Iconic Bentley models are the Bentley 4½ Litre, Bentley Speed Six, Bentley R Type Ls, Bentley Turbo R, and Bentley Arnage. As of 2015, Bentley produce the Ls Flying Spur, Continental GT, Bentley Bentayga and this Mulsanne.Rolls-Royce bought Bentley from your receivers in 1931 and subsequently sold it to help Vickers plc in 1980 when Rolls-Royce themselves went bankrupt. In 1998, Vickers sold it to help Volkswagen AG. The sale included your vehicle designs, model nameplates, production and administrative facilities, the Spirit of Fervor and Rolls-Royce grille condition trademarks, but not the rights towards the Rolls-Royce name or logo which are owned by Rolls-Royce Holdings plc as well as were licensed to BMW AG.Before World War When i, Walter Owen Bentley, and his brother, Horace Millner Bentley, sold French DFP autos in Cricklewood, North London, but W. O, as Walter was acknowledged, always wanted to design and build his or her own cars. At the DFP manufacturing facility, in 1913, he noticed an light weight aluminum paperweight and thought that aluminum could be a suitable replacement with regard to cast iron to fabricate light pistons. The first Bentley aluminum pistons were suited to Sopwith Camel aero applications during World War We.In August 1919, W. O. registered Bentley Motors Ltd. and in October he exhibited a motor vehicle chassis, with dummy engine, at the London Engine Show. Ex-Royal Flying Corps police officer, Clive Gallop, designed an innovative 4 valves per cylinder engine for the chassis. By December the powerplant was built and working. Delivery of the 1st cars was scheduled pertaining to June 1920, but development took longer than estimated to ensure the date was extended to September 1921. The durability of the primary Bentley cars earned widespread acclaim and they competed in hill climbs as well as raced at Brooklands.Bentley's first major function was the 1922 Indiana 500, a race, dominated by specialized cars and trucks with Duesenberg racing chassis. They entered a changed road car driven through works driver, Douglas Hawkes, accompanied by riding auto mechanic, H. S. "Bertie" Browning. Hawkes completed the total 500 miles and finished 13th having an average speed of 74. 95 mph after starting off in 19th position. The team was then rushed time for England to compete in the 1922 RAC Tourist Trophy.Captain Woolf BarnatoIn ironic reference to be able to his heavyweight boxer's prominence, Captain Woolf Barnato seemed to be nicknamed "Babe". In 1925, he acquired his first Bentley, a 3-litre. With this car he or she won numerous Brooklands backrounds. Just a year later he acquired the Bentley organization itself.The Bentley enterprise has been always underfunded, but inspired by the particular 1924 Le Mans gain by John Duff in addition to Frank Clement, Barnato agreed to fund Bentley's business. Barnato had incorporated Baromans Ltd in 1922, which existed as their finance and investment auto. Via Baromans, Barnato initially invested well over £100, 000, saving the business and workforce. A financial reorganisation in the original Bentley company was executed and all existing creditors repaid for £75, 000. Existing shares were devalued through £1 each to simply 1 shilling, or 5% or the original value. Barnato held 149, 500 of the completely new shares giving him control with the company and he started to be chairman. Barnato injected further cash into the business: £35, 000 secured by debenture within July 1927; £40, 000 in 1928; £25, 000 in 1929. With renewed financial insight, W. O. Bentley was able to style another generation of autos.

Your Bentley Boys were a small grouping of British motoring enthusiasts in which included Woolf Barnato, Sir Henry "Tim" Birkin, steeple chaser George Duller, aviator Glen Kidston, automotive journalist S. C. H. "Sammy" Davis, and Dr Dudley Benjafield. The Bentley Boys, favored Bentley cars. Many were independently wealthy and frequently had a military backdrop. They kept the marque's reputation for high end alive; Bentley was noted due to the four consecutive victories on the 24 Hours of The Mans from 1927 to 1930.In 1929, Tim Birkin developed the particular 4½ litre, lightweight Blower Bentley on Welwyn Garden City along with produced five racing packages, starting with Bentley Blower No. 1 which was optimised for the Brooklands racing circuit. Birkin overruled W. O. and put the model available before it was thoroughly developed. As a result, it was unreliable.

In March 1930, during the Blue Teach Races, Woolf Barnato raised the particular stakes on Rover and its particular Rover Light Six, having raced and defeated Le Train Bleu for the 1st time, to better that record along with his 6½-litre Bentley Speed Six with a bet of £100. He drove against the actual train from Cannes to Calais, then by ferry for you to Dover, and finally London, travelling on public motorways, and won.

Barnato driven his H. J. Mulliner-bodied formal saloon inside race against the Glowing blue Train. Two months later, on 21 May 1930, he took delivery of an Speed Six with structured fastback "Sportsman Coupé" through Gurney Nutting. Both cars became generally known as the "Blue Train Bentleys"; the latter is often mistaken for, or erroneously referred to as being, the car that raced the Blue Train, while in fact Barnato branded it in memory associated with his race. [19][20] A painting by simply Terence Cuneo depicts the particular Gurney Nutting coupé race along a road parallel to the Blue Train, which scenario never occurred because the road and railway would not follow the same course.
